    Normally, with an amp, that is not enough delay.
    Listen to your signal on a dummy load and increase delay until it stops the clicks.

    If the amplifier does not switch into transmit quickly enough, it will "hot switch", resulting in clipping off the leading edge of the carefully shaped CW signal from the Flex. Result: terrible key clicks.

    Rise time is not adjustable in the Flex. Looking at the QST review, I seem to remember it was around 5 ms which is the textbook sweet spot. The shaping is very good so the barefoot Flex is not likely to generate bad clicks. I will have to look at the band using full duplex to see how wide my 6400 keying is. The higher the keying speed, the wider it will be. 73, Len, KD0RC
